Liberal Leader Justin Trudeau will be in Saskatoon Thursday. He is appearing at a campaign rally at the Delta Bessborough scheduled for 5 to 7:30 p.m.
The Liberal Leader is making headlines around the world. First it was a photo in brown face dressed up as Aladdin, then it was Justin Trudeau admitting to another incident in black face and now a video has surfaced.
He admitted he wore black face as Harry Belafonte singing the Banana Boat Song in a high school talent contest.
And this morning, Global News broadcast a brief video showing what appears to be Trudeau in blackface raising his hands in the air and sticking out his tongue.
The photo of him dressed as Aladdin, he was 29 at the time, was released by Time magazine. It was taken at the private school where he taught before entering politics. It was the school’s “Arabian Nights” themed dinner.
The Prime Minister held a hastily organized news conference yesterday telling reporters that he’s angry and disappointed in himself and says he should have known better. He also apologized and asked Canadians to forgive him acknowledging it was a racist act, though he didn’t realize it at the time, but Trudeau says he knows better now.
The rally this evening in Saskatoon is free, but the Facebook event page is asking for RSVPs. The three Saskatoon ridings all have Liberal candidates. Of the 14 Saskatchewan ridings, 11 have Liberal candidates. The three ridings without are Cypress Hills-Grasslands, Souris-Moose Mountain, and Yorkton-Melville.
